The Herbal Syrup with extract of ivy leaf helps to relieve cough & cold for your child

This syrup tastes like honey and contains ivy leaf extract, an expectorant of natural source! Since ancient times, ivy has been known to treat bronchitis and colds. It helps to soothe coughs, clear the airways and treat inflammation of the bronchi. It relieves coughs and loosens mucus & phlegm.

Medicinal Ingredient

– Each 1 mL contains: Ivy extract (Hedera helix, leaves) (4-7:1) – 7.955 mg
– Equivalent to 31.82 mg – 55.68 mg of dried Ivy leaf

Non-Medicinal Ingredients

– Purified water
– Sorbitol
– Xanthan gum
– Potassium sorbate
– Citric acid
– Honey flavour

Dosage:

Children 0 – 1 year of age:
2.5ml (1/2 teaspoon), once daily

Children 1 – 4 years of age:
2.5ml (1/2 teaspoon), twice daily

Children 04-12 years of age:
5ml (1 teaspoon), 1 – 2 times per day

Consult your healthcare practitioner for use beyond 7 days.

Caution:

Do not use if security seal is broken or missing.
Consult a healthcare practitioner if symptoms persist or worsen.
Consult a healthcare practitioner prior to use in children with gastritis or gastric ulcers.
Consult a healthcare practitioner prior to use in children less than 2 years of age.
Consult a healthcare practitioner immediately if your child has a fever, difficulty breathing, purulent expectoration, or is coughing up blood.
Consult a healthcare practitioner before taking with an opiate antitussive like codeine or dextromethorphan.
Do not use if your child is allergic to plants from the Araliaceae family, sorbitol or any of the other ingredients listed.
